# HOW TO EDIT THIS FILE:
# The "handy ruler" below makes it easier to edit a package description.  Line
# up the first '|' above the ':' following the base package name, and the '|'
# on the right side marks the last column you can put a character in.  You must
# make exactly 11 lines for the formatting to be correct.  It's also
# customary to leave one space after the ':'.

guile-compat32: This is Guile, Project GNU's extension language library.  Guile is an
guile-compat32: interpreter for Scheme, packaged as a library that you can link into
guile-compat32: your applications to give them their own scripting language.  Guile
guile-compat32: will eventually support other languages as well, giving users of
guile-compat32: Guile-based applications a choice of languages.
